Technical specifications for Q170BAT

ManufacturerMitsubishi
Product LineMelsec-Q
Part NumberQ170BAT
Weight0.81 lbs (0.37 kg)
Voltage Rating24 volts nominal
Current Rating1 amp maximum load
Connector Type2 pin connector
Wire CountThree wire configuration
Mounting StyleSurface mount design option
Battery TypeCompatible with rechargeable batteries
Operating Temperature-20°C to 60°C
MaterialDurable plastic construction used
Wire Gauge22 AWG wire thickness
PolarityCorrect polarity required connection
InsulationHigh-quality insulation material used
ComplianceRoHS compliant

The Mitsubishi Q170BAT is an essential part of the Melsec-Q series, tailored for reliable connections in automation systems. It operates at a nominal voltage of 24 volts, with a maximum load current of 1 amp. The design incorporates a two-pin connector, arranged in a three-wire setup, to facilitate straightforward wiring.

Crafted for surface mounting, this component is versatile in installation options. It is suitable for use with rechargeable batteries, enhancing its functionality in various applications. The operating temperature ranges from -20°C to 60°C, providing flexibility for diverse environments.

Manufactured from durable plastic, the Q170BAT ensures longevity and resilience under typical operating conditions. With a wire gauge of 22 AWG, the product meets requirements for quality and performance. High-quality insulation is applied to prevent any electrical issues, and users should ensure the correct polarity during installation. The module also adheres to RoHS standards, confirming its compliance with environmental regulations.
